What are the risks and rewards of investing in cryptocurrencies compared to Lucid stocks?

When it comes to investing, what are the potential risks and rewards of putting your money into cryptocurrencies instead of Lucid stocks? How do these two investment options differ in terms of volatility, potential returns, and long-term stability?

- Padgett CooperMay 17, 2023 · 2 years agoInvesting in cryptocurrencies can be highly rewarding, with the potential for significant returns. However, it also comes with a higher level of risk compared to investing in Lucid stocks. Cryptocurrencies are known for their volatility, with prices often experiencing rapid fluctuations. This volatility can lead to both substantial gains and losses, making it a high-risk investment option. On the other hand, Lucid stocks tend to be more stable and predictable, offering a lower level of risk but potentially lower returns. It ultimately depends on your risk tolerance and investment goals.
- Jolene BradfordDec 07, 2024 · 8 months agoInvesting in cryptocurrencies is like riding a roller coaster. The potential rewards can be exhilarating, with some investors making massive profits in a short period. However, the risks are equally high. Cryptocurrencies are highly volatile, and their prices can swing wildly based on market sentiment, regulatory changes, and other factors. Unlike Lucid stocks, which are backed by tangible assets and regulated markets, cryptocurrencies are decentralized and subject to greater uncertainty. It's important to carefully consider your risk appetite and do thorough research before diving into the world of cryptocurrencies.
